GLP-1s (full name: glucagon-like peptide-1 receptor agonists, or GLP-1 agonists) help the pancreas release insulin, reduce blood sugar, slow the rate of stomach emptying, and increase feelings of fullness, explains Gretchen Zimmermann, RD, a registered dietitian specializing in obesity and vice president of clinical strategy at Vida Health

We note that, because adult height is treated as constant during the treatment window, the percentage change in BMI (BMI % ) is mathematically identical to the percentage change in weight (weight % )
